Date At Red Road Flats

Dale had a date at Red Road Flats, but the girl he's at had no need of him. She had gone out walking with her dog, and wasn't there at Red Road Flats. So Dale went knocking on her door on the top floor of Red Road Flats. There was no barking of the dog, for sure, in Red Road Flats, in Red Road Flats. He stood there an hour beside the door of Red Road Flats, and was so bored... Eventually, the girl's he's at came home with Smog, the little dog. "What are you doing here?" said the girl he's at at Red Road Flats. For that rudeness, Dale was floored, and says no more she's the girl he's at. ---------------------------------------------- 1/13/2016 Contest - Strand Selection 6 Sponsor - Brian Strand 2nd place win
